Soft and Chewy Mojito Cookies

These soft and chewy mojito cookies are a fun twist on a classic treat, infused with refreshing hints of lime and mint. With a tender texture and bright citrus flavor, they’re perfect for a unique dessert that feels light, fresh, and slightly tropical.

 

Ingredients

Scale

1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
1/2 cup granulated sugar
1/2 cup light brown sugar, packed
1 large egg
2 tablespoons milk
2 teaspoons vanilla extract (alcohol-free)
1/8 teaspoon spearmint extract (or to taste)
1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
Lime zest, for garnish (such as Key limes)
Fresh mint leaves, for garnish

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
  • Add the egg, milk, vanilla extract, and spearmint extract, mixing until smooth.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
  •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until a soft dough forms.
  • Scoop tablespoon-sized portions of dough and place them on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ing them apart.
  • Bake for 10–12 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den and the centers remain soft.
  • Remove from the oven and let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
  • Garnish with lime zest and fresh mint leaves before serving.
